how long do these things record for?

Forever… on a loop.

how long is the loop?

Depends how big the SD card is your using with it. I use an 8 Gig card in mine. It can record about 2.5 hours of footage in 1 minute segments / files before starting again and over writing the earliest recorded files.
To be honest though it matters not unless your into watching hours of road / driving with sod all happening.
If there’s an incident, you can save the file from being over written with the press of a button or have the camera set to do it itself, these are called “Event” files. I disabled it in mine though because I kept getting lots of event files when in fact it was a speed bump or a poor bit of road- my truck bounces like a ■■■■■■■■

I’ve got this one in my van
amazon.co.uk/E-PRANCE-Origin … ds=eprance

It’s quite small and sits behind the rear view mirror out of sight. I’ve put a class 4 SD card in and gives a very good image when downloaded to my laptop, number plates are easily read. It records as soon as you plug it in / switch the engine on (if it’s hard wired). You can set it to record audio as well.

I simply forget it’s there and less than £60.
